Welcome to Il Motore, the intimate live music space in Montréal that evolved into Bar Le Ritz P.D.B. (Punks Don’t Bend) in 2014. Known for a dedicated stage and a flexible layout, this ground-floor venue specializes in indie rock, punk, and electro acts, drawing local and international artists. With a typical capacity around 150–250 depending on configuration, the venue offers a close, high-energy listening experience in a city rich with music culture. Good to know
Seating, Parking & Venue Information
- Original address: 179 Rue Jean-Talon Ouest, Montréal, QC H2R 2X2; Il Motore operated there until around 2014.
- Renamed Bar Le Ritz P.D.B. (Punks Don’t Bend) in 2014 and continues as Bar Le Ritz PDB today.
- Typical capacity cited around 150–250 depending on configuration; older sources list ~200–225 as a common range.
- Venue type: small bar/club with a dedicated stage, primarily standing room with limited seating; ground-floor, wheelchair accessible.
- Seating chart: plan exists (Plan Bar Le Ritz P.D.B.) and is referenced on the venue’s site and third-party listings.
- Parking: on-street parking nearby; no dedicated on-site lot; paid street parking common in the area.
- Transit: near Montreal transit hubs; Moovit lists proximity to Jean-Talon (Orange/Blue lines) and De Castelnau stations; expect 5–15+ minute walks depending on exact stop.

- Notable events hosted: POP Montreal festival involvement; indie rock/punk/electro programs; former co-owners connected to Godspeed You! Black Emperor; acts like TOPS, Thus Owls, and various international indie acts have performed there.
